Chicago gets set for the new season

Training Camp in Chicago starts in less than 24 hours, and the Bulls community is buzzing. With Deng and Gordon reported to be the next Jordan and Pippen combination that the Bulls have missed for 7 years is a prospect which will excite all neutral basketball fans. Rookie Thabo Sefolosha is also in the spotlight, his athleticism and etermination will go a long way if the Chicago Bulls are to make the 06/07 season one of their best.
Although they are a very young group of players, the Chicago Bulls play more mature and controlled, flowing basketball thatn many teams in the National Basketball Association. Scott Skiles has built from grass roots, bringing in young players, some soon to be some of the greatest in their later years. Summer signing "Big" Ben Wallace and P.J Brown will lead the way with experience in importnat situations, portraying confidence onto their younger team-mates, when and if that happens, Scott Skiles and Chicago surely will have a recipe for succes.
"This season is a campaign which all of our fans can look forward to. You only have to look at our roster to see how much strength and depth we have." Says Skiles. "I have told PJ and Ben that they needn't worry about the responsibility of carrying the team. It would be helpful, but if the situation does not occur, one of the young guns will pull through and take control. It has happened in the past. Look at Chris Bosh of the Raptors; when Vince (Carter) left for New Jersey, he was faced with so much pressure on his shoulders, at a very young age. After a bad start, and a locker-room argument, Bosh and the Raptors have moved up, and even made i the play-offs last season. We have a perfect "family" atmosphere and all of the guys treat each other like brothers, and when you have that you can't go wrong."
Skiles, his team and the Chicago Bulls fans seem to be very confident about their new season, and looking at the line-up, its not hard to see why.

Gordon's 36 Get Bulls Of To A Flying Start

Image

Image Bulls 125 - 100 Bobcats Image

Ben Gordon couldn't have opened his 2007/08 season much better, he shot straight to the top of the Points league with an outstanding 36 baskets. Gordon continually found ways to get into the lane and with his superb scoring ability caused the Charlotte defence trouble all night.
But it wasn't Gordon's performance that turned the most heads. Yi Jianglian, 8th pick in the 2007 NBA Draft posted 34 points and 11 rebounds on his debut in the NBA. The Chinese Power-Forward used his height well and crashed the boards well from the 2cnd quarter onwards, earning most of his points from second chance opportunities.
Brevin Knight did his part to keep the visiting Bobcats in the game, with 36 points and 7 assists. Unfortunately for him, his teammates just couldn't get into the flow and the Chicago home crowd unsetelled them, leading to clumsy passes and silly shots. Emeka Okafor threw away 7 shots on the defensive end but he was the only Charlotte player that was anticipating every shot and rebound. Gerald Wallace was probably the Bobcats best player, he scored 22 points, grabbed 10 rebounds and dished out 4 assists, but as many times shown before, he can't do it on his own.
Ben Wallace shew off his ability to the home crowd with arguably his best performance in a Bulls jersey. The former defensive player of the year finished up with 17 points, 19 boards and 9 blocks, an excellent all-round performance from an excellent player. A very convincing start to the season and the Bulls fans went home happy.


Player Of The Game - Ben Wallace - 17pts, 19rebs, 9blks

Wallace's excellent fourth quarter leads Bulls to victory in first real test

Image

Image Nets 92-100 Bulls Image

The Chicago Bulls travelled to the Continental Airlines Arena for their first road game of the season and their first real test. With easy wins over the Bobcats and Washington Wizards, Scott Skiles' team were going to have to be at their best to overcome Jason Kidd and Vince Carter - the most lethal partnership in the NBA.
Things were looking bleak for the Bulls at the start of the fourth quarter, with Kidd absolutely inihilating them on the offensive end. Luckily, Ben Wallace was about to pick up his game. Big Ben swatted away 4 shots and scored 10 points in the first four minutes, and carried on strong throught the rest of the quarter. Vince Carter could get absolutely nothing going in the 2cnd half, and Kidd was forced onto the bench due to foul trouble. Kirk Hinrich was relentless the entire game, even with JK5 at his best, Hinrich stuck to his task well and caused the Nets interior defence trouble with his finishing ability and change of pace. Hinrich finished up with 31 points and 8 assists.
Ben Gordon wasn't AS impressive as his first two games, but he still put on a good show with 20 points and 4 assists to silence the home crowd, he hit the three pointer with 4 seconds left on the shotclock to tie the game late.
Jason Kidd was on form, Kidd posted 25 points and 3 assists, hitting every open shot he was given. Chicago managed to keep Vince Carter relatively quite with 16 points and 7 rebounds, but a 7 point deficit wipe-out and an 81% FG in the fourth quarter meant the Bulls stayed underfeated in their quest for glory.


Player Of The Game - Kirk Hinrich - 31pts, 8assts, 3stls
